According to its “Handbook for New Employees,” Company Z is a flat organization. The handbook reads: “That’s why Company Z is flat. It’s our shorthand way of saying that we don’t have any management, and nobody ‘reports to’ anybody else. We do have a founder/president, but even he isn’t your manager. This company is yours to steer—toward opportunities and away from risks. You have the power to green-light projects. You have the power to ship products.” Company Z, on a continuum, can be classified closer to the organic side.
